France to Netherlands: What You Need to Know

The Netherlands and France are both founding EU members and Schengen partners. French citizens cross into the Netherlands without passport controls and enjoy full EU freedom of movement. No visa or prior authorization is required.

French nationals can live and work in the Netherlands indefinitely. For stays beyond three months, registration at the local municipality (gemeente) is required. The Netherlands uses the euro.

Your French national identity card is accepted as a valid travel document. Direct TGV rail connections from Paris to Amsterdam make the journey under four hours.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do French citizens need a visa for the Netherlands?

No. France and the Netherlands are both founding EU and Schengen members. French citizens travel there freely with no border controls.

How long does the train from Paris to Amsterdam take?

The direct Thalys/Eurostar train from Paris Gare du Nord to Amsterdam Centraal takes approximately 3 hours 20 minutes.

Does the Netherlands use the euro?

Yes. The Netherlands uses the euro, the same as France.

Can French citizens work in the Netherlands?

Yes. EU freedom of movement grants French nationals the right to live and work in the Netherlands without any permit.
